PDP presidential candidate, Alhaji Atiku Abubakar , has promised to aggressively tackle youth employment if elected as president next year, promising to ensure that ten billion dollars is earmarked for youth empowerment programmes in order to make the young people in the country get gainfully employed and earn a decent living .
While noting that Kwara state connects the north and the south, he lamented that the interstate roads are now in a deplorable state because the roads infrastructure provided by the PDP –led administrations were not maintained by the APC government. He has therefore promised that his administration will fix such roads.
He also lamented the worsening security situation in the country promising to end safety fears and ensure security of lives and property if elected as president next year.
While submitting that there is ‘insecurity’ everywhere in the country which he called one of the failures of the APC government, Atiku advised Nigerians to reject getting deceived and misled. ‘Don’t let them come here to deceive you or tell you lies’ he said.
Team@orientactualmags.com learned Atiku said this while addressing party members and supporters during the PDP North Central Presidential Campaign rally held at the Metropolitan Square, Ilorin on Thursday.

National Chairman of the party, former senator Iyorchia Ayu, said PDP is one big united family for all adding that the party has come to rescue the country .
He said Alhaji Atiku Abubakar was actually elected as the party’s presidential candidate because ‘he is a unifier who will rebuild the country’.
Ayu noted that the time has come to vote for all the PDP candidates adding that this should be done next year.
PDP Vice Presidential candidate, Governor Ifeanyi Okowa also asked Nigerians to vote for the party in the next year’s presidential election saying ‘everyone is tired of insecurity and hunger’ , he also condemned the APC-led administration for allowing students at public universities to stay at home for more than eight months while saying the PDP leaders would on Sunday this week, attend the inauguration ceremony of former senator Ademola Adeleke as sixth executive governor of Osun state in Osogbo which will according to him mark the beginning of the taking over of South West and the entire country.
Former Senate President, Dr Abubakar Bukola Saraki said Atiku will rebuild Nigeria if elected as president , the PDP presidential candidate will also according to him end insecurity, hunger and address all the problems facing the country.
He urged Kwarans to vote for Atiku Abubakar , who , he noted, had professed and shown his love for Kwarans right from his relationship with his late father, Dr Olusola Saraki.

Kwara state PDP gubernatorial candidate, Alhaji Shuaib Yaman Abdulahi also submitted that in 2019, the mantle of leadership in the state fell from ‘a performing government to a government that doesn’t know what to do or how to care about the people’s welfare’ . He urged Kwarans to do the needful by voting for PDP candidates in the upcoming General election.
He also claimed that in the 55 years that Kwara state had existed, the total debts before the Abdulrahman Abdulrazaq administration came on board was N59 billion but that this now stands at N114 billion as the current administration has added N55 billion to it.
He added that should Kwarans allow the governor to get re-elected in 2027, the debts will increase to N300 billion and that there may be no funds to attend to people’s needs.
